Re: are you having problems posting
Quote:
The change that Gareth made now makes a difference in "new posts" and "today's posts." To see something you just posted, it is now a two click step instead of one. Using Avalon Electric forum skin On the top right side click "Quick Links" from the drop down menu the first option is "Today's Posts" The Faraday cage thread has now moved to page 2. http://www.projectavalon.net/forum/s...ead.php?t=1086 "New Posts" Brings up a different set of postings now as described by Alyscat. http://www.projectavalon.net/forum/s...6&postcount=15 The new features are actually the ones I'm used to in vBulletin - partcularly in the electric skin/ Click on New posts and you see the new posts since you last logged on, and then you see posts that are recent that have had changes that you haven't viewed. I'm guessing based on your USER CP designation of how many days to cover. This was the way I did it as a moderator of a pretty active site. (not this one) This has been a delight for me, but for others who are used to something else, probably not so great. This lets me know exactly what has been changed since I last logged on, and at the same time, if I didn't choose to view a thread on my last login, it posts it at the bottom. To get rid of all of it, when you login to the main part (which shows how many users are online) you can choose to mark all threads as read. alys |
